Today no cricket matches so we move for the today's big football match, 1st Semi final of the 2013 FIFA Confederations Cup Brazil vs Uruguay played at Estadio Mineirao, Belo Horizonte on 26th June 2013. Here find the live streaming links.



For Brazil, David Luiz is able to return to center=back, despite coming off against Italy with a leg injury. Paulinho was left out of that game, though could replace Hernanes in central midfield again. That midfield adjustment has been the only inconsistency in Brazil's starting XIs so far this tournament, and Scolari probably won't make any changes now.

As for Uruguay, anything is possible when serial tinkerer Óscar Tabárez is in charge. He's already tried two different defensive formations so far this tournament, and it's anyone's guess as to how and with who he'll set La Celeste up here. One definite is Andrés Scotti is out suspended, having become the first player of the tournament to pick up a red card. However, at 37 years old, the center-back won't be missed.

New Zealand won by 5 runs against England in the 1st T20I Cricket match Played at Kennington Oval, London on 25th June 2013. New Zealand held their nerve at the death and sealed a thrilling 5-run victory over Eng. The hosts, chasing a mammoth 201/4, were restricted to 196/5. Rutherford and B McCullum cracked sparkling fifties for New Zealand

England were right in the chase from the word go. Openers Lumb and Hales got them off to a blazing start. Luke Wright continued the good work and got to his fifty. But the visitors chipped in at regular intervals to keep a check on the run flow. It was down to 35 from the last 3 overs thanks to a cameo from Bopara. But he was left stranded at the other end as Nathan McCullum, Ian Butler and Corey Anderson did the job for the Kiwis in the final overs and helped their side take an unassailable 1-0 lead in the 2-match T20I series.

India won by 5 runs against England in the ICC Champions Trophy 2013 final match Played at Edgbaston, Birmingham on 23rd June 2013. Due to rain match reduced to 20 overs. India beat England by 5 runs in a thriller at Edgbaston to win the 2013 ICC Champions Trophy. Kohli hit a quickfire 43 while R Ashwin and Ravindra Jadeja picked up 2 wickets each.
